Year of Gratitude - Day 58 - Southfield Public Library

The Southfield Public Library is my favorite public library. I have so many great memories and lifelong friends from this place. As new graduate student, I visited SPL to complete an assignment. My old supervisor, Nancy Beets, handed me a pre-printed set of answers to my assignment's questions. That first encounter was quick, because the library was rocking. It is still rocking, but a little less than before.

As an intern, I learned from the best librarians in one of the busiest libraries in southeast Michigan. Once we limited computer use for nonresidents, we saw a drop in traffic on the floors. People love free computer and internet service. I sharpened my reference skills and picked up some pretty swell reader's advisory knowledge. Weeding the history and philosophy collections was also pretty great.
